Babuka Bahuara
Babuka Bahuara is a village located in Kochas subdivision of Rohtas district in Bihar,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Kochas (tehsildar office) and 50km away from district headquarter Sasaram. As per 2009 stats, Kuchhila is the gram panchayat of Babuka Bahuara village.

About Babuka Bahuara
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Babuka Bahuara is 250620. The village spans a total geographical area of 134 hectares. Sasaram is nearest town to Babuka Bahuara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 50km away.

Population of Babuka Bahuara
Below is a concise population overview of Babuka Bahuara as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 830 | 447 | 383 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 161 | 95 | 66 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 243 | 129 | 114 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 515 | 309 | 206 |
Illiterate Population | 315 | 138 | 177 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Babuka Bahuara village:
- The total population of Babuka Bahuara village is around 830, including approximately 447 males and 383 females, with a sex ratio of 856 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 161 children aged 0–6 years in Babuka Bahuara village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Babuka Bahuara village has 243 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Babuka Bahuara village is about 62.05%, with male literacy at 69.13% and female literacy at 53.79%.
- There are around 116 households in Babuka Bahuara village.
Connectivity of Babuka Bahuara
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Babuka Bahuara. As per the 2011 stats, Babuka Bahuara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
